The Marrowgate partner SFTP drop accepts nightly inventory files from approved partners; our ingest poller sweeps the drop every fifteen minutes and validates filenames against the manifest schema. Reviewers should note the poller never deletes source files — archival happens downstream in Cratewell. The poller authenticates to the internal Dropwarden service on startup, using the credential that appears on the following line.

gateway credential: kto3_qfe

Minutes — Management Meeting, Harlowe & Finch Ltd

Attendees: regional leads and operations staff. The main item was the 18% reduction to the marketing budget for the coming half-year. Sponsorships in the Norbury district will end; digital campaigns for the Brightline service continue at reduced spend. Branch managers should submit revised local plans within two weeks. Questions go to the operations desk. The confidential note on how these savings feed into wider business plans appears below.

board note of tadup-fahag: The board signed off on a budget of $42.0 million for Project Fenath.

## Idempotency Keys for Payment Retries (Lumopay)

Every retry of a charge request must reuse the original idempotency key; generating a new key on retry can produce duplicate charges. Keys are scoped per merchant and expire after 48 hours. Reviewers should verify keys are derived server-side, never from client input. The full key-generation specification and threat model are maintained on the internal page.

dashboard of kaguf-tawip = https://vault.merlaqsys.test/issue

## Account Recovery — Trailnote Offline Mode

When a surveyor's Trailnote app has been offline for 30+ days, their local credentials expire and sync refuses to resume. Don't make them wipe the device — all their unsynced field data lives there! Instead, open the support console, pick "Offline Reinstate," and enter their handle. The console will ask for the support team's shared recovery passphrase before issuing a reinstatement token. Use the one below.

unlock words, bagaf-fajeg: zorael-kelax-fraath-quenix-eliok-sileth-aldmir-wenir-druiel